Seven Days of City Experiences and Foodie Delights in India

Day 1: Historic Delhi Introduction

Delhi, India

8:00AM

Visit Jama Masjid

Start your day with a visit to the magnificent Jama Masjid, India's largest mosque, and take in the stunning architecture and history.
INR 300, 2 hours

1:00PM

Lunch at Karim's

Indulge in Mughlai cuisine at Karim's near Jama Masjid, known for its delectable kebabs and biryanis.
INR 800, 1 hour

4:00PM

Explore Chandni Chowk

Wander through the bustling streets of Chandni Chowk, one of the oldest markets in Delhi, and shop for souvenirs and local treats.
Free, 2 hours

7:00PM

Dinner at Indian Accent

End your day with a fine dining experience at Indian Accent, known for its modern Indian cuisine and innovative dishes.
INR 2500, 2 hours

Day 2: Royal Jaipur Exploration

Jaipur, India

9:00AM

Visit Amber Fort

Embark on a journey to Amber Fort, a stunning blend of Rajput and Mughal architecture, and don't miss the elephant ride up to the fort.
INR 500, 3 hours

1:00PM

Lunch at Laxmi Misthan Bhandar

Savour traditional Rajasthani thali and sweets at Laxmi Misthan Bhandar, a renowned eatery in Jaipur.
INR 400, 1 hour

4:00PM

Explore City Palace

Discover the rich history of Jaipur at the City Palace, a magnificent complex with museums, courtyards, and royal artefacts.
INR 300, 2 hours

8:00PM

Dinner at Spice Court

Treat yourself to authentic Rajasthani dishes at Spice Court, known for its traditional flavours and cultural ambience.
INR 1000, 2 hours

Day 3: Enchanting Agra Day

Agra, India

8:00AM

Visit Taj Mahal

Begin your day with a visit to the iconic Taj Mahal, a symbol of love and a masterpiece of Mughal architecture, and witness its enchanting beauty.
INR 1300, 2 hours

12:00PM

Lunch at Pinch of Spice

Enjoy a scrumptious North Indian meal at Pinch of Spice, known for its diverse menu and great hospitality.
INR 700, 1 hour

3:00PM

Explore Agra Fort

Immerse yourself in history at Agra Fort, a UNESCO World Heritage Site with impressive gates, palaces, and gardens.
INR 650, 2 hours

7:00PM

Dinner at Dasaprakash

End your day with a South Indian culinary experience at Dasaprakash, offering authentic flavours and a diverse menu.
INR 800, 1.5 hours

Day 4: Spiritual Varanasi Exploration

Varanasi, India

6:00AM

Morning Ganges Boat Ride

Experience the spiritual aura of Varanasi with an early morning boat ride on the Ganges River, witnessing the rituals and devotion along the ghats.
INR 200, 1.5 hours

9:00AM

Breakfast at Blue Lassi

Indulge in a traditional Indian breakfast with a variety of flavoured lassis at Blue Lassi, a famous spot amongst locals and travellers.
INR 150, 1 hour

12:00PM

Visit Sarnath

Explore Sarnath, an important Buddhist site near Varanasi, where Lord Buddha gave his first sermon, and visit the museum to delve into its history.
INR 100, 2 hours

7:00PM

Dinner at Open Hand Cafe

Enjoy organic and vegetarian delights at Open Hand Cafe, known for its fresh, healthy menu and serene ambience.
INR 500, 2 hours

Day 5: Cultural Kolkata Immersion

Kolkata, India

9:00AM

Visit Victoria Memorial

Start your day with a visit to Victoria Memorial, an iconic monument representing Kolkata's colonial heritage, and explore the lush gardens and museum.
INR 200, 2 hours

1:00PM

Lunch at 6 Ballygunge Place

Relish traditional Bengali cuisine at 6 Ballygunge Place, known for its authentic dishes like fish curry and mishti-doi.
INR 800, 1 hour

4:00PM

Explore Howrah Bridge

Walk across the iconic Howrah Bridge, a major landmark in Kolkata, and witness the bustling life along the Hooghly River.
Free, 1 hour

8:00PM

Dinner at Oh! Calcutta

Delight your taste buds with a diverse mix of Bengali and North Indian cuisine at Oh! Calcutta, offering a fusion of flavours and fine dining experience.
INR 1200, 2 hours

Day 6: Mumbai Vibrant Experience

Mumbai, India

10:00AM

Visit Gateway of India

Begin your day at the iconic Gateway of India, a historic monument overlooking the Arabian Sea, and capture the essence of Mumbai's bustling waterfront.
Free, 1 hour

1:00PM

Lunch at Britannia & Co.

Enjoy Parsi cuisine at Britannia & Co., a heritage restaurant in Mumbai known for its berry pulav and caramel custard.
INR 600, 1 hour

4:00PM

Explore Dharavi Slum Tour

Embark on a guided tour of Dharavi, Asia's largest slum, to gain insight into the community's resilience, industry, and unique way of life.
INR 500, 2 hours

8:00PM

Dinner at Gajalee

Treat yourself to authentic Malvani seafood at Gajalee, a renowned restaurant in Mumbai offering a diverse menu of coastal delicacies.
INR 1500, 2 hours

Day 7: Tech Hub Bangalore Exploration

Bangalore, India

10:00AM

Visit Lalbagh Botanical Garden

Start your day at Lalbagh Botanical Garden, a haven for nature lovers with diverse flora, peaceful lakes, and majestic trees, perfect for a leisurely stroll.
INR 40, 2 hours

1:00PM

Lunch at MTR - Mavalli Tiffin Room

Indulge in South Indian classics at MTR, a legendary eatery in Bangalore known for its idlis, dosas, and filter coffee.
INR 500, 1 hour

4:00PM

Explore Cubbon Park

Stroll through Cubbon Park, a green oasis in the heart of Bangalore city, ideal for nature enthusiasts, joggers, and picnickers.
Free, 2 hours

7:00PM

Dinner at Toit

Conclude your culinary journey at Toit, a popular brewery in Bangalore offering a variety of craft beers and delicious wood-fired pizzas.
INR 1200, 2 hours
